Analysis of the Relationship between GM and IMO Intact Stability Parameters to Propose Simple Evaluation Methodology

Resumen

Securing a ship?s safe stability is essential. Thus, monitoring the stability parameters of the IMO requirements is required to provide an alert about the risk of the safety of ships? stability to the captain, officers, and the crew of a ship. However, calculating all ships? intact stability parameters is complex without ship loading software or equipment. To evaluate ships? intact stability parameters, a convenient methodology to simply calculate them is necessary as a supplementary method for ships in the absence of loading software or equipment. In the present study, the Simple Evaluation Methodology for Intact Stability (SEMIS) is proposed. SEMIS is introduced for simply evaluating the safety of ships? stability according to GM. Based on the stability parameters of 336 loading conditions of 19 model ships, empirical formulas of SEMIS are derived. To verify the proposed methodology, the stability parameters of two model ships in 28 loading conditions are calculated using the proposed empirical formulas and the principal calculation methods, respectively, and then compared. The developed SEMIS efficiently evaluates the ships? stability using only GM.
